2. \”The Human Microbiome Project\”
The Human Microbiome Project is a collaborative study that aims to understand the complex ecosystem of microorganisms that live in the human body. It has made significant contributions to our understanding of the role of microorganisms in disease and has led to the development of new treatments and prevention strategies.
